My version (and only my version) of Word opens very slowly, that is, it
takes a long time to load. Our company has a global template that loads
automatically, and I recall a message posted here a while ago about
something in the VBA code of the template that causes Word to load slowly.
Can someone elaborate on that?

Why would only my machine be affected by whatever this is? I have a lab
machine right next to me that uses the same global template, and Word loads
very quickly and easily. All the toolbars work, all the buttons respond
quickly. My main machine has a faster processor and more RAM than the lab
machine. Further, no one else in the organization who uses these global
templates has this issue.

It's not a show-stopper, but I'm very curious about this behavior, and I
will appreciate any suggestions.

Close down Word and then find your Normal.dot and then rename it. See if
that makes a difference.

Now, there could be other issues. For example if the start-up template is
shared on a LAN somewhere (yuck!) then this could be a problem. Or it
could be running some code and looking for some drive or other which
doesn't exist and it's off hunting for it.
